Highest Education Level
- Bachelor's Degree (23.3%)
- Vocational Degree or Certification (23.3%)
- High School or GED (22.5%)
- Associate's Degree (18.3%)
- Master's Degree (4.1%)
- Doctorate Degree (4.0%)
- Some College (3.8%)
- Some High School (0.8%)
Average Work Experience
- None (26.6%)
- 10+ years (22.2%)
- 2-4 years (19.5%)
- 6-8 years (11.1%)
- 8-10 years (6.8%)
- 4-6 years (6.3%)
- 1-2 years (5.8%)
- Less than 1 year (1.7%)
